zabbix agent 修改为主动模式

 默认zabbix agent为被动模式,被动模式是指zabbix agent 被动从zabbix server 端接受指令然后收集被监控端的信息,收集完毕之后再将信息传递给zabbix server端。此种方式可能会使zabbix server端面临比较大的负载状况,故可以修改为主动模式来使zabbix agent端主动向server 端要数据。

注意一点,zabbix agent 主动模式,是不起监听的。

具体步骤如下:

1、复制zabbix模板,将其修改为主动模式。

1)复制模板

2)将其修改为主动模式

备注:选择监控项,之后全选

备注:点击批量更新

备注:如图点击后,保存。

 

2、zabbix web添加机器

备注:其实这里这个ip添加与否,zabbix server 都不会去找的,我的理解。。。

选择刚刚修改的模板。

 

 

3、修改zabbix agent 端配置文件,设置为主动模式

# grep '^[a-Z]' /etc/zabbix/zabbix_agentd.conf 
PidFile=/var/run/zabbix/zabbix_agentd.pid
LogFile=/var/log/zabbix/zabbix_agentd.log
LogFileSize=0
StartAgents=0
ServerActive=172.16.1.177
HostnameItem=system.hostname
Include=/etc/zabbix/zabbix_agentd.d/*.conf

备注:如上修改配置文件,标红部分可以自行百度,或者查看配置文件

之后重启 zabbix agent

3、查看zabbix web的最新数据

截图显示,在该段时间是有数据。

查看主机状态。

这里主机状态是红色,如不明其中原因,可以自行百度。

其实我也不懂,都是度娘给的,或者官网。。。

 

~~~~~~~~~~~~~~~~~~~~

~~~~~~~~~~~~~~~~~~~

完!!

 

posted @ 2017-12-17 23:05  Star-Hitian  阅读(548)  评论(0)    收藏  举报